Dan Zou Xingqiang Lü Shunsheng Zhao Xiangrong Liu

The mol-ecule of the title compound, C(23)H(18)Cl(2)N(4)O, assumes a non-planar conformation in which the pyrazolone ring forms dihedral angles of 32.61 (19), 76.73 (14) and 52.57 (19)° with the three benzene rings. Thitipone Suwunwong Suchada Chantrapromma Hoong-Kun Fun

In the title mol-ecule, C(21)H(19)N(3)O(2), the central pyridine ring makes dihedral angles of 14.46 (9) and 34.67 (8)° with the 4-amino- and 4-eth-oxy-substituted benzene rings, respectively. The eth-oxy group is essentially coplanar with the attached benzene ring [C-O-C-C torsion angle = 178.70 (16)°] as is the meth-oxy group with the pyridine ring [C-O-C-N torsion angle = -3.0 (3)°]. Jerry P. Jasinski Ray J. Butcher K. Veena B. Narayana H. S. Yathirajan

In the title compound, C(15)H(10)BrClO, the dihedral angle between the mean planes of the benzene rings in the ortho-bromo- and para-chloro-substituted rings is 70.5 (6)°. The dihedral angles between the mean plane of the prop-2-en-1-one group and the mean planes of the benzene rings in the 4-chloro-phenyl and 2-bromo-phenyl rings are 14.9 (3) and 63.3 (8)°, respectively. Xu-Hong Yang Ming-Hu Wu

In the title mol-ecule, C(16)H(15)FN(4)O, the dihedral angle between the fluoro-substituted benzene ring and the pyrimidinone ring is 52.34 (7)°, while the dihedral angle between the fused benzene ring and the pyrimidinone ring is 3.30 (6)°.
